The widely used herbal antidepressant kava is damaging to the liver. Pregnant women should avoid most herbal remedies because of pesticides and preservatives required in the growth and storage of the herbs. Most ayurvedic medicines contain unacceptable levels of lead and other heavy metals. St. John's Wort could complicate any chronic medical condition. Many people see herbal remedies as "natural" and therefore safe, but in Prescription or Poison? Dr. Amitava Dasgupta explains that one of his first pharmacology professors taught him that "medicine" is just another word for "poison" and all medicines of any kind should be treated with great caution. This book, written for the layperson but based on solid science and research, explains how toxic many alternative remedies can be, alone or in combination with widely prescribed drug treatments. He includes detailed information on the proper use of alternative medicines and their history of good results, while also cautioning readers in this wake-up call about the casual, often uninformed, and sometimes damaging use of alternative remedies.

Light Treatments for Depression: Bright Light Treatments Lifts Mood

So many options for the treatment of Depression are available today and advances are continually being made. One form of Depression is SAD or Seasonal Affective Disorder.

Due to the lack of exposure to sunlight, especially during late Fall and Winter, many people become depressed and they may not realize exactly why they are so low when winter rolls around. It is particularly prevalent in Alaska where there is darkness for half a year and daylight for half a year.

Light treatments for Depression are probably one of the safest treatments available. The user sits in front of the unit with the light shining in their eyes. There are a number of different light therapies available and they are briefly discussed below.

Fluorescent Light Box - has an intensity of 2,500 - 11,000 lux where the user is about 1 to 2 inches away from the box.

Light Intensity - this is also used at a particular distance.

Light weight portable boxes - these are mounted on a stand for easy use.

Full Spectrum Light is not necessary; The intensity is the most important aspect of light therapy.

Balance of spectrum light minus UV-B emissions are ideal.

Your symptoms and diagnosis will tell doctors which type of light therapy may be the best choice for you.

SAD - Season Affective Disorder has some of the same components of other disorders and may respond to other types of treatments for Depression. Other treatments include holistic treatments, traditional medications and psychotherapy, and herbal treatments to name a few.
